The claim that numbers on a Social Security card can be used as a routing and account number to make purchases is FALSE, based on our research. The Fed has debunked the claim on numerous occasions.
Theres no single tool that shows every account linked to your SSN. However, you can take these steps to uncover most of them: Check your credit reports and visit AnnualCreditReport.com. Check IRS records and review your tax transcripts.
